NEIGHBORHOOD EMPLOYMENT CENTERS
Functional Area: Administration/Sub-Award Project Type: Recurring, Special Revenue Project Responsible Department: HUMAN RESOURCES AND CIVIL SERVICE COMMISSION Project Manager: Assistant Director, Pittsburgh Partnership
Capital Improvement Program
Project Description
This program supports six neighborhood Employment Centers located in various parts of the City. These centers are charged with providing job opportunities for City residents by creating a network of neighborhood employment projects.
Project Justification
Supporting employment services improves the quality of life for all residents.
Shows capital project funding by source and year.
Operating Budget Impact
This project is managed by Community Development Block Grant-funded personnel, so there is no operational cost to the City.
